Browsing the selection procedure for a window installer can be overwhelming, however following these steps can streamline the task.
Action 1: Research Local Options
Start by compiling a list of prospective window installers in your area. Use the list below resources:
Google Search: Simply search for "window installer near me" to gain access to local organizations.Online Marketplaces: Websites like Angie's List, Yelp, and HomeAdvisor can offer client reviews and scores.Local Casement Window Installer Recommendations: Ask friends, family, or realty representatives for their tips.Action 2: Check Qualifications and Experience
When you have a list of prospective installers, examine their credentials. The following credentials can indicate a trusted professional:
Licensing and Insurance: Ensure they are licensed to operate in your region and carry appropriate insurance protection.Certifications: Look for certifications from makers like Andersen, Pella, or Simonton, which indicate specialized training.Experience: The installer ought to have a tested performance history. Preferably, they must have several years of experience in the industry.Action 3: Get Quotes
Contact at least three installers to obtain quotes. Be prepared to offer information about your existing windows and any specific requirements you might have. When comparing quotes, think about the following:
Cost Breakdown: Look for openness in pricing, detailing products, labor, and any extra fees.Guarantee Options: Inquire about guarantees on both the windows and the installation work.Step 4: Review Contracts and contracts
Before signing any agreement, carefully read the contract. Validate that it includes:
Pricing and payment termsSet up start and conclusion datesInformation about permits, if appropriateService warranty infoCleanup and disposal treatmentsStep 5: Communication and Customer Service
Assess the company's interaction design and customer care. Reliable installers should be responsive and going to address any questions you may have throughout the procedure. Great interaction can conserve misconceptions later on.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much does it usually cost to work with a window installer?
The cost can differ greatly based upon the type of windows, the intricacy of the installation, and your location, however property owners can an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per Experienced Window Installer, consisting of labor and materials.
2. The length of time does window installation take?
Typically, the installation process can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a couple of days, depending upon the number of windows and the kind of installation required.
3. What kinds of windows can installers handle?
Professional window installers typically deal with a variety of window types, consisting of v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ass windows. They may likewise install specific windows like bay or bow windows.
4. Are there any permits required for window installation?
License requirements can differ by area. It's recommended to examine local building codes or consult your installer to see if a permit is necessary for your task.
5. What should I do if I see concerns after installation?
Many reliable installers offer warranties that cover setups. If you see concerns, call your installer without delay to discuss the scenario and check out possible resolutions.
